Philips and Laerdal brands of HeartStart HS1 Defibrillator Family Model number M5066A, M5067A, and M5068A Automated External Defibrillator Manufactured by Philips Medical Systems, Seattle, WA 98121 USA. The HS1 Defibrillator is intended to treat ventricular fibrillation, the most common cause of sudden cardiac arrest. Using voice prompts, light emitting diodes (LEDs) and buttons, the user is guided through the response. The HS1 uses a SMART biphasic, impedance compensating exponential waveform to deliver a nominal 150 J to adults and nominal 50 J to infants/children.

Reprocessed Pressure Tourniquet Cuff (PTC) Tourniquet cuffs are single- or dual-bladder inflatable cuffs connected to a tourniquet system via a hose assembly. When wrapped around a limb and inflated, tourniquet cuffs apply an adequate amount of pressure on the arterial blood flow in a limb to create a bloodless surgical field. Tourniquet cuffs are available in a variety of sizes to accommodate a wide range of limb circumferences.
